The Internet protocol (IP) consisted the basely communication mechanism of Internet, and the fourth version of IP protocol has been used for more than twenty years. With the number of Internet users increasing exponentially, and Internet extend its scope almost to everywhere worldwide. Furthermore, Internet has met many serious problem: address exhausted, route table expanded, less support to the network security and multimedia application.To meet the users' new needs of more IP address space, better network performance and better security, the next genaration Internet protocol (IPv6) has been come into being. We can solve the most of problem of IPv4 by using IPv6.In this article, a plan of IPv6 testbone construction of China Education and Rearch Network (CERNET) in Hunan province has been put forward.This article is composed of two units:Unit 1: this unit includes Chapter 1, Chapter 2. In Chapter 1, we mainly introduce the source and purpose of the project being designed and complement. In Chapter 2, we discuss the specialty of IPv4 and IPv6, and the implementation of transition mechanism of changing IPv4 to IPv6 and we choose Tunnel Broker as our method to build up IPv6 testbed.Unit 2: this unit includes Chapter 3, Chapter 4 and Chapter 5. In Chapter 3, we introduce the IPv6 testbed research status worldwide and how to implement IPv6 protocol in different software and hardware platform. The key question of testbed construction is put forward in detail. We implement the IPv6 protocol in Linux and Windows Platform by ourselves with a research propose. Some modules of these two platform has been changed by us, such as C lib, API fuction and DLL. Furthermore, we discuss the detailed configuration and implement structure of IPv6 testbone of CERNET Changsha node. In Chapter 4, we introduce the result of testing this testbone. In Chapter 5 we introduce our applied IPv6 testbed address and official address and summarize the main works written in this dissertation.The testbone that we discuss in this article has been proved to achieve the function we planned, and the theory of this project is implemented properly and rationally.
